The provider is a Registered Clinical Social Worker Intern. Ms. Laura Cowell is a dedicated clinical therapist with a deep passion for helping individuals, families, and adolescents navigate life’s challenges with clarity, compassion, and resilience. With a Master of Social Work from Troy University and a Bachelor of Social Work from Northwestern State University, Laura brings both academic excellence and lived experience to her work with clients. As a military spouse of over 15 years, Laura understands firsthand the unique pressures faced by military families—frequent relocations, deployments, transitions, and reintegration challenges. Her personal insight and professional training allow her to create a safe, supportive space for those seeking to be heard, understood, and empowered. Laura has worked in diverse settings, including schools, community-based programs, and private practice. Her clinical experience includes providing therapy to children with emotional impairments, supporting individuals and families through trauma, and working with military-connected clients. She integrates a variety of evidence-based therapeutic approaches, including: * Trauma-Focused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(TF-CBT) *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) *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) * Motivational Interviewing * SPARCS (Structured Psychotherapy for Adolescents Responding to Chronic Stress) Laura specializes in treating anxiety, trauma, emotional dysregulation, life transitions, and stress related to military service. Her approach is warm, collaborative, and client-centered, focusing on building trust and developing tools for long-term wellness. Laura is currently accepting new clients in Florida through virtual appointments. Whether you're a parent concerned about your teen, a service member managing life stressors, or an individual looking for support, Laura is here to help.

What is your typical process for working with clients?

My process is collaborative, supportive, and tailored to each individual’s needs. During our first session, we’ll focus on getting to know one another. I’ll ask questions to better understand your history, current challenges, goals, and what brought you to therapy. This initial session is all about building a foundation of trust and creating a safe, judgment-free space where you feel comfortable opening up. From there, we’ll work together to identify your goals and create a personalized treatment plan. Depending on your needs, I may draw from a variety of evidence-based approaches, including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Trauma-Focused CBT (TF-C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), Motivational Interviewing, and SPARCS. I work with both adolescents and adults, and I especially enjoy supporting individuals who are managing anxiety, trauma, emotional dysregulation, or the complex challenges of military life. A typical session might involve discussing recent experiences, exploring emotions or thought patterns, and practicing new coping skills or communication techniques. I often assign optional reflection exercises or strategies to try between sessions, helping you apply what you’re learning in real life. I believe therapy should be empowering and flexible. You set the pace, and I’ll walk beside you—sometimes guiding, sometimes listening, always supporting. Whether you're coming in with a clear goal or just trying to make sense of things, I’m here to help you feel more balanced, understood, and equipped to handle life’s challenges.
